database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
ㆍPost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
PostgreSQL Q&A 7672 게시물 읽기
No. 7672
csv import 할때에 만드시 테이블을 정의해주고 해야하나요?...
작성자
성제호(s_jeho)
작성일
2009-04-03 03:14
조회수
7,049

csv 값이 엄청나게 긴 값이 있습니다.
거의 한 200여개의 컬럼으로 나눠져있는데..
이 엄청난 컬럼의 헤더부분이 없고 순수히 자료만 있는 csv입니다.

헤더의 내용이야 뭐 얼추 임의로 입력하게하고(1,2,3,4,5,6.....200)
나중에 정확히 파악되는걸 alter 로 컬럼명을 바꾸려고하는데,

문제는 이 방대한 양의 csv를 import 하려면 미리 테이블이 정의가 되어있어야 하는가 입니다.

한두개가 아니라 200여개가 되니까.. 도저히 답이 안나오네요

csv 값에 헤더값이 있다면, 묻지도 따지지도 않고 바로 테이블 생성하면서 자료를 입력하게 할수 있을까요?
엄청나게 많은 컬럼으로 나눠져있다, 그런데 헤더명은 잘 모른다-
이런경우 어떻게 진행할수 있을까요..?ㅠㅠ

이 글에 대한 댓글이 총 1건 있습니다.

윈도우에서 ODBC 사용하면 가능합니다.


해당파일을 Excel이나 Access에서 읽어들여서 pgsql의 ODBC를 통해서 export하면 자동으로 헤더값이 지정됩니다.


아리수님이 2009-04-03 13:34에 작성한 댓글입니다. Edit
[Top]
No.
제목
작성자
작성일
조회
7676쿼리를 어떻게 만들면 빠르게 조회가 가능할까요. [1]
이기자
2009-04-06
6691
7674Bindings were not allocated properly 팝업이... [1]
2009-04-03
6803
7673dump 를 하지 않고 data를 백업하는 방법 [1]
길재
2009-04-03
6885
7672csv import 할때에 만드시 테이블을 정의해주고 해야하나요?... [1]
성제호
2009-04-03
7049
7671pgpool 기본포트로 접속시 질문드립니다
김태규
2009-04-02
6506
7670월별자료 boxplot [1]
chunrima
2009-04-02
7007
7669쿼리좀... [1]
초짜
2009-04-01
7448
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.073초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다